I use my UPAD to mark up on PDF files. Is there a way to convert a Kindle books to PDF so I can make notes and highlight in UPAD?
 
Most Kindle files have DRM protection, and cannot be converted to PDF without removing that first. Stripping DRM, even for private use conversion with no intent to distribute, is illegal in most countries, so methods to do so cannot be discussed here.

Having said that, you can highlight and annotate within the Kindle app, and your highlights and notes are then searchable through your Amazon account via http://kindle.amazon.com.
